body,
button,
input,
select,
textarea,
h1,
h2,
h3,
h4,
h5,
h6 {
    font-family: Microsoft YaHei, Tahoma, Helvetica, Arial, sans-serif;
}

.x-fontsize-10 {
    font-size: 10px;
}

.x-fontsize-11 {
    font-size: 11px;
}

.x-fontsize-12 {
    font-size: 12px;
}

.x-fontsize-13 {
    font-size: 13px;
}

.x-fontsize-14 {
    font-size: 14px;
}

.x-fontsize-15 {
    font-size: 15px;
}

.x-fontsize-16 {
    font-size: 16px;
}

.x-fontsize-17 {
    font-size: 17px;
}

.x-fontsize-18 {
    font-size: 18px;
}

.x-fontsize-19 {
    font-size: 19px;
}

.x-fontsize-20 {
    font-size: 20px;
}

.x-fontsize-21 {
    font-size: 21px;
}

.x-fontsize-22 {
    font-size: 22px;
}

.x-fontsize-23 {
    font-size: 23px;
}

.x-fontsize-24 {
    font-size: 24px;
}

.x-fontsize-25 {
    font-size: 25px;
}

.x-fontsize-26 {
    font-size: 26px;
}

.x-fontsize-27 {
    font-size: 27px;
}

.x-fontsize-28 {
    font-size: 28px;
}

.x-fontsize-29 {
    font-size: 29px;
}

.x-fontsize-30 {
    font-size: 30px;
}


/*fontsize*/

.x-color-white {
    color: #FFF;
}

.x-color-black {
    color: #000;
}

.x-color-gray {
    color: #666666;
}

.x-color-gray-01 {
    color: #aaa;
}

.x-color-blue {
    color: #47A1D3;
}

.x-color-red {
    color: #F4AA30;
}


/*color*/

.x-margin-0 {
    margin: 0;
}

.x-margin-left-0 {
    margin-left: 0;
}

.x-margin-left-5 {
    margin-left: 5px;
}

.x-margin-left-10 {
    margin-left: 10px;
}

.x-margin-left-15 {
    margin-left: 15px;
}

.x-margin-left-20 {
    margin-left: 20px;
}

.x-margin-left-25 {
    margin-left: 25px;
}

.x-margin-left-30 {
    margin-left: 30px;
}

.x-margin-left-35 {
    margin-left: 35px;
}

.x-margin-left-40 {
    margin-left: 40px;
}

.x-margin-left-45 {
    margin-left: 45px;
}

.x-margin-left-50 {
    margin-left: 50px;
}

.x-margin-right-0 {
    margin-right: 0;
}

.x-margin-right-5 {
    margin-right: 5px;
}

.x-margin-right-10 {
    margin-right: 10px;
}

.x-margin-right-15 {
    margin-right: 15px;
}

.x-margin-right-20 {
    margin-right: 20px;
}

.x-margin-right-25 {
    margin-right: 25px;
}

.x-margin-right-30 {
    margin-right: 30px;
}

.x-margin-right-35 {
    margin-right: 35px;
}

.x-margin-right-40 {
    margin-right: 40px;
}

.x-margin-right-45 {
    margin-right: 45px;
}

.x-margin-right-50 {
    margin-right: 50px;
}

.x-margin-top-0 {
    margin-right: 0;
}

.x-margin-top-5 {
    margin-right: 5px;
}

.x-margin-top-10 {
    margin-top: 10px;
}

.x-margin-top-15 {
    margin-top: 15px;
}

.x-margin-top-20 {
    margin-top: 20px;
}

.x-margin-top-25 {
    margin-top: 25px;
}

.x-margin-top-30 {
    margin-top: 30px;
}

.x-margin-top-35 {
    margin-top: 35px;
}

.x-margin-top-40 {
    margin-top: 40px;
}

.x-margin-top-45 {
    margin-top: 45px;
}

.x-margin-top-50 {
    margin-top: 50px;
}

.x-margin-bottom-0 {
    margin-bottom: 0;
}

.x-margin-bottom-5 {
    margin-bottom: 5px;
}

.x-margin-bottom-10 {
    margin-bottom: 10px;
}

.x-margin-bottom-15 {
    margin-bottom: 15px;
}

.x-margin-bottom-20 {
    margin-bottom: 20px;
}

.x-margin-bottom-25 {
    margin-bottom: 25px;
}

.x-margin-bottom-30 {
    margin-bottom: 30px;
}

.x-margin-bottom-35 {
    margin-bottom: 35px;
}

.x-margin-bottom-40 {
    margin-bottom: 40px;
}

.x-margin-bottom-45 {
    margin-bottom: 45px;
}

.x-margin-bottom-50 {
    margin-bottom: 50px;
}


/*margin*/

.x-padding-0 {
    padding: 0;
}

.x-padding-5 {
    padding: 5px;
}

.x-padding-10 {
    padding: 10px;
}

.x-padding-15 {
    padding: 15px;
}

.x-padding-20 {
    padding: 20px;
}

.x-padding-25 {
    padding: 25px;
}

.x-padding-30 {
    padding: 30px;
}

.x-padding-35 {
    padding: 35px;
}

.x-padding-40 {
    padding: 40px;
}

.x-padding-45 {
    padding: 45px;
}

.x-padding-50 {
    padding: 50px;
}

.x-padding-left-0 {
    padding-left: 0;
}

.x-padding-left-5 {
    padding-left: 5px;
}

.x-padding-left-10 {
    padding-left: 10px;
}

.x-padding-left-15 {
    padding-left: 15px;
}

.x-padding-left-20 {
    padding-left: 20px;
}

.x-padding-left-25 {
    padding-left: 25px;
}

.x-padding-left-30 {
    padding-left: 30px;
}

.x-padding-left-35 {
    padding-left: 35px;
}

.x-padding-left-40 {
    padding-left: 40px;
}

.x-padding-left-45 {
    padding-left: 45px;
}

.x-padding-left-50 {
    padding-left: 50px;
}

.x-padding-right-0 {
    padding-right: 0;
}

.x-padding-right-5 {
    padding-right: 5px;
}

.x-padding-right-10 {
    padding-right: 10px;
}

.x-padding-right-15 {
    padding-right: 15px;
}

.x-padding-right-20 {
    padding-right: 20px;
}

.x-padding-right-25 {
    padding-right: 25px;
}

.x-padding-right-30 {
    padding-right: 30px;
}

.x-padding-right-35 {
    padding-right: 35px;
}

.x-padding-right-40 {
    padding-right: 40px;
}

.x-padding-right-45 {
    padding-right: 45px;
}

.x-padding-right-50 {
    padding-right: 50px;
}

.x-padding-top-0 {
    padding-top: 0;
}

.x-padding-top-5 {
    padding-top: 5px;
}

.x-padding-top-10 {
    padding-top: 10px;
}

.x-padding-top-15 {
    padding-top: 15px;
}

.x-padding-top-20 {
    padding-top: 20px;
    color:white;
}

.x-padding-top-25 {
    padding-top: 25px;
}

.x-padding-top-30 {
    padding-top: 30px;
}

.x-padding-top-35 {
    padding-top: 35px;
}

.x-padding-top-40 {
    padding-top: 40px;
}

.x-padding-top-45 {
    padding-top: 45px;
}

.x-padding-top-50 {
    padding-top: 50px;
}

.x-padding-bottom-0 {
    padding-bottom: 0;
}

.x-padding-bottom-5 {
    padding-bottom: 5px;
}

.x-padding-bottom-10 {
    padding-bottom: 10px;
}

.x-padding-bottom-15 {
    padding-bottom: 15px;
}

.x-padding-bottom-20 {
    padding-bottom: 20px;
}

.x-padding-bottom-25 {
    padding-bottom: 25px;
}

.x-padding-bottom-30 {
    padding-bottom: 30px;
}

.x-padding-bottom-35 {
    padding-bottom: 35px;
}

.x-padding-bottom-40 {
    padding-bottom: 40px;
}

.x-padding-bottom-45 {
    padding-bottom: 45px;
}

.x-padding-bottom-50 {
    padding-bottom: 50px;
}


/*padding*/

.x-bg {
    background: none;
}

.x-bg-01 {
    background: #000;
}

.x-bg-02 {
    background: #FFF;
}

.x-bg-03 {
    background: #F5F5F5;
}

.x-bg-04 {
    background: #f2f0f0;
}

.x-bg-05 {
    background: #00afe7;
}

.x-bg-06 {
    background: #1f1f1f;
}


/*background*/

.x-border {
    border: none;
}

.x-border-01 {
    border: solid 1px #CCC;
}


/*boder*/

.uk-navbar {
    background: #003366;
    color: #444;
    height: 42px;
}

.uk-navbar-nav>li {
    float: left;
    position: relative;
}

.uk-navbar-nav>li>a {
    padding: 0 35px;
}

.uk-navbar-nav>li>a:hover {
    background: #00afe7;
}

.uk-navbar-nav>li:hover,
.tm-uk-active {
    background: #00afe7;
    border-bottom: 2px solid green;
}

.uk-div-01 {
    background: url(../images/banner.jpg) no-repeat fixed;
    background-size: cover;
    min-height: 727px;
    height: 100%;
}

.uk-div-02 {
    background: url(../images/banner06.jpg) no-repeat fixed;
    background-size: cover;
    min-height: 401px;
    height: 100%;
}

.uk-div-03 {
    background: url(../images/service.jpg) no-repeat fixed;
    background-size: cover;
    height: 413px;
}

.uk-div-04 {
    background: url(../images/why.jpg) no-repeat fixed;
    background-size: cover;
    height: 413px;
}

.uk-div-05 {
    background: url(../images/contact01.jpg) no-repeat fixed;
    background-size: cover;
    height: 413px;
}

.uk-div-06 {
    background: url(../images/contact02.jpg) no-repeat fixed;
    background-size: cover;
    height: 525px;
}

.uk-div-07 {
    background: url(../images/plans.jpg) fixed #292828;
    height: 277px;
}

.uk-button-yellow {
    background-color: #00afe7;
    color: #666;
    padding: 5px 30px 5px 30px
}

.uk-button-yellow:focus,
.uk-button-yellow:hover {
    background-color: #000;
    color: #fff
}

.uk-button-yellow.uk-active,
.uk-button-yellow:active {
    background-color: #0091ca;
    color: #fff
}

.uk-button-black {
    background-color: #000;
    color: #FFF;
    padding: 5px 30px 5px 30px
}

.uk-button-black:focus,
.uk-button-black:hover {
    background-color: #FFF;
    color: #666
}

.uk-button-black.uk-active,
.uk-button-black:active {
    background-color: #0091ca;
    color: #fff
}

.uk-thumbnav-01 {
    display: -ms-flexbox;
    display: -webkit-flex;
    display: flex;
    -ms-flex-wrap: wrap;
    -webkit-flex-wrap: wrap;
    flex-wrap: wrap;
    margin-left: -10px;
    margin-top: -10px;
    padding: 0;
    list-style: none
}

.uk-thumbnav-01>* {
    -ms-flex: none;
    -webkit-flex: none;
    flex: none;
    padding-left: 10px;
    margin-top: 10px
}

.uk-thumbnav-01:after,
.uk-thumbnav-01:before {
    content: "";
    display: block;
    overflow: hidden
}

.uk-thumbnav-01:after {
    clear: both
}

.uk-thumbnav-01>* {
    float: left
}

.uk-thumbnav-01>*>* {
    display: block;
}

.uk-thumbnav-01>*>*>img {
    opacity: 1;
    -webkit-transition: opacity .15s linear;
    transition: opacity .15s linear
}

.uk-thumbnav-01>*>:focus>img,
.uk-thumbnav-01>*>:hover>img {
    opacity: 0.7
}

.uk-thumbnav-01>.uk-active>*>img {
    opacity: 0.7
}


/*user-defined*/
